Court of Appeal quashes Donna Anthony's conviction — the CCRC-referral precedent
The Court of Appeal (Criminal Division) quashes Donna Anthony's 1998 conviction for the murder of her two infant children. Unlike Clark and Cannings (whose acquittals came via second direct appeals), Anthony's acquittal came via CCRC referral — the same statutory route the October 2025 Letby application is taking. Establishes that a first-appeal dismissal does not foreclose later CCRC review.
